This short 7 minute episode recounts the recent moment when I realized I do not need to carry all the details of my experience of someone’s story as much as I need to carry the gift their story left me with. 
I don’t need to remember names, dates and places so much as needing to remember what the experience may have taught me. But in learning this, I was momentarily caught off guard by a feeling of being inadequate, a feeling of being old and a feeling of being unworthy of the honor being given when I am invited into the inner sanctum of someones death.
